2005 Ford Five Hundred vs. 2003 Lamborghini Murcielago

To start off, 2005 Ford Five Hundred is newer by 2 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2003 Lamborghini Murcielago.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2003 Lamborghini Murcielago would be higher. At 6,192 cc (12 cylinders), 2003 Lamborghini Murcielago is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2003 Lamborghini Murcielago (563 HP @ 7500 RPM) has 360 more horse power than 2005 Ford Five Hundred. (203 HP @ 6000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2003 Lamborghini Murcielago should accelerate faster than 2005 Ford Five Hundred.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Ford Five Hundred weights approximately 80 kg more than 2003 Lamborghini Murcielago.

Because 2003 Lamborghini Murcielago is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2005 Ford Five Hundred.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2003 Lamborghini Murcielago will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2003 Lamborghini Murcielago (650 Nm @ 5400 RPM) has 369 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Ford Five Hundred. (281 Nm @ 4500 RPM). This means 2003 Lamborghini Murcielago will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Ford Five Hundred.

Compare all specifications:

2005 Ford Five Hundred 2003 Lamborghini Murcielago
Make Ford Lamborghini
Model Five Hundred Murcielago
Year Released 2005 2003
Body Type Sedan Convertible
Engine Position Front Middle
Engine Size 2982 cc 6192 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 12 cylinders
Engine Type V V
Valves per Cylinder 4 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 203 HP 563 HP
Engine RPM 6000 RPM 7500 RPM
Torque 281 Nm 650 Nm
Torque RPM 4500 RPM 5400 RPM
Drive Type Front 4WD
Number of Seats 5 seats 2 seats
Vehicle Weight 1730 kg 1650 kg
Vehicle Length 5100 mm 4590 mm
Vehicle Width 1900 mm 2050 mm
Vehicle Height 1530 mm 1070 mm
Wheelbase Size 2650 mm 2670 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 72 L 100 L
